Question:Security of RH850 cannot be set even if the security setting is added to the YDD file.

To set the security in the microcontroller with FR830,
it is necessary to set the MCU Operation Mode to "Security Settings"
in addition to setting the security (address #00000002) in the YDD file.
(See FR830 Instruction Manual chapter 2-2-1)

<MCU Operation Mode setting values for AZ490>
0000 (default): No security setting, No option byte setting
0001: Security setting, No option byte setting
0010: No security setting, option byte setting
0011: Security setting , option byte setting


*After changing the setting values on the AZ490 screen,press the "OK" button
at the right end of the screen to reflect the setting values in the programmer.

Security is the protect settings against read, write, and erase when using in command protection mode.
The option byte setting is made at address #00000040 in the YDD file.
